WebAug 10, 2024 · Physical activity boosts blood supply to the feet and helps prevent diabetic neuropathy. 7. Avoid smoking. Diabetic patients who smoke tend to have uncontrolled blood sugar levels. Smoking also has a negative effect on blood circulation and is associated with a higher risk of foot and toe ulcers. (8) 8. WebApr 29, 2024 · Your health care provider can usually diagnose diabetic neuropathy by performing a physical exam and carefully reviewing your symptoms and medical history. Your health care provider typically checks your: Overall muscle strength and tone. Tendon reflexes. Sensitivity to touch, pain, temperature and vibration.
